sycl: coalesce the ssm_conv window loads (llama/26612)
test-backend-ops perf -o SSM_CONV on an Arc Pro B70, interleaved A/B against master, 6 reps, us/run: ne_a=[515,3328,1,1] ne_b=[4,3328,1,1] n_t=512 97.68 -> 52.95 1.85x ne_a=[937,8192,1,1] ne_b=[4,8192,1,1] n_t=934 516.16 -> 276.13 1.87x ne_a=[4,3328,1,1] ne_b=[4,3328,1,1] n_t=1 2.73 -> 2.71 flat llama-bench on qwen35 27B Q4_K - Medium (48 of its 64 blocks run ssm_conv), -ngl 99 -fa 1 -ctk f16 -ctv f16, interleaved passes of r=3: -b 2048 -ub 2048 pp2048 1045.1 / 1043.5 / 1043.7 -> 1069.5 / 1066.3 / 1065.9 +2.2% -b 2048 -ub 512 pp2048 771.8 / 772.7 -> 785.5 / 786.6 +1.8% -b 2048 -ub 512 tg128 23.81 / 23.88 -> 23.87 / 23.86 flat
